Mailinglisten-Archive |
Hallo Michael > if (file_exists($hashpath)) { > readfile($hashpath); > exit; > } > > Es steht direkt nach der Festlegung der Variablen. > Das Bild wird dann also gar nicht erst erstellt. Ups das habe ich übersehen...:) Dann muss ich sagen Hut ab, das ist ja richtig gut... Ich habe das Problem das ich aus eine DB Tortendiagramme mit sehr dynamischen Inhalt (Stundenprotokolle) erstelle. D.h. die Diagramme (Images) sind fast jedes mal mit neuen Inhalten versehen... Ich habe das so gelöst das ich 5 Files (so viele Diagr. brauche ich) erzeuge und diese immer wieder überschreibe... Großer Nachteil dieser Sache ist das ich im Browser immer wieder neu laden muss wenn ich ein andere DB Diagramm Abfrage durchführe... Und ein Verzeichnis mit Files zu füllen und "irgendwann" per cron Script zu leeren gefällt mir irgendwie nicht sonderlich gut. Eine Überlegung ist im Moment, die Images in meine Mysql DB zu schreiben in ein Blob (geht das den?) und mit meiner Session ID zu verknüpfen und dann diese Images bzw. den DB Eintrag nach Ablauf der Sessions zu löschen... Performance ist nicht sooo wichtig läuft alles im Intranet... Obwohl es im Moment schon länger als 3 Sec. dauert eine Übersicht über Tages/Wochen und Monats Arbeitszeiten abzufragen und die 5 dazugehörenden Diagramme (png's) zu erzeugen... Hat das schon mal jemand umgesetzt? Grüsse Thomas
php::bar PHP Wiki - Listenarchive